> I've tried this on my local wiki:
>
> [[(% class="myclass" %)[[image:XWikiLogo.png||width="25" 
> height="25"]]>>http://xwiki.org]]
>
> And it generates:
>
> <p><span class="wikiexternallink"><a href="http://xwiki.org";><span 
> class="myclass"><img 
> src="http://localhost:8080/xwiki/bin/download/Sandbox/WebHome/XWikiLogo.png?width=25&amp;height=25";
>  width="25" height="25" alt="XWikiLogo.png"/></span></a></span></p>
>
> So as you can see it does generate a<span>.
>
> Now if you want the params to apply to the img tag you need to pass them as 
> image params:
>
> [[[[image:XWikiLogo.png||width="25" height="25" 
> class="myclass"]]>>http://xwiki.org]]
>
> which generates:
>
> <p><span class="wikiexternallink"><a href="http://xwiki.org";><img 
> src="http://localhost:8080/xwiki/bin/download/Sandbox/WebHome/XWikiLogo.png?width=25&amp;height=25";
>  width="25" height="25" class="myclass" alt="XWikiLogo.png"/></a></span></p>
>
> Hope it's clear.

>>>>> Seems I haven't yet understood all the nuances of XWiki syntax:
>>>>>
>>>>> According to http://platform.xwiki.org/xwiki/bin/view/Main/XWikiSyntax
>>>>>
>>>>> I can have a sized image with [[image:img.png||width="25" height="25"]]
>>>>> I can have an image with a link [[image:img.png>>http://xwiki.org]]
>>>>>
>>>>> How can I have a sized image with a link ?
>>>>> not working:
>>>>> [[image:img.png||width="25" height="25">>http://xwiki.org]]
>>>> not correct
>>>>
>>>>> [[image:img.png>>http://xwiki.org||width="25" height="25"]]
>>>> not correct either
>>>>
>>>> You need:
>>>>
>>>> [[[[image:img.png||width="25" height="25"]]>>http://xwiki.org]]
>>> What you need to understand is that you have wiki syntax inside a link label
>>>
>>> In [[linklabelhere>>reference]], linklabelhere is wiki syntax.
>>>
>>> The wiki syntax to specify an image with params is [[image:...||params]].
>>>
